Successfully launching a Minimum Viable Product (MVP) is a major milestone for any startup. However, transitioning from this stage to achieve sustainable growth can be a challenging yet rewarding journey.

One of the initial steps includes fine-tuning your product based on customer feedback. This process helps in aligning the product features with market demands, thereby improving customer satisfaction and retention.

In addition, expanding the customer base is crucial. Engage in targeted marketing campaigns that highlight your unique selling proposition, and explore partnerships that can amplify your reach and credibility.

Securing investment is another crucial aspect for scaling. Early-stage funding can drive development efforts, while Series A or B rounds could support commercialization and market penetration.

Adopting efficient operation processes is also essential. Streamlining development and customer service processes, while leveraging automation and AI tools, can drastically enhance performance and scalability.

Finally, embedding a resilient company culture that values innovation and flexibility can empower teams to navigate the complexities of scaling.

Scaling post-MVP requires a balanced mix of strategic planning, market awareness, and financial foresight. By effectively capitalizing on these areas, startups can transition into robust enterprises prepared to accelerate growth.
